London firefighters extinguish tower block blaze

The London Fire Brigade says it has tackled a blaze at a residential tower block in the southeast of the capital, adding that there were no reports of any injuries.

“Ten fire engines and around 70 firefighters tackled a fire at a block of flats on Rosenthal Road in Catford. Two flats were alight. There are currently no reports of any injuries,” the fire brigade said in a statement.

The cause of the fire was under investigation.

The incident comes on the day a public inquiry published its report on the 2017 Grenfell Tower fire in which 72 people died.
